Emory Tate’s Chess Career Highlights
Emory Tate’s chess career was marked by numerous achievements and unforgettable moments. He was a five-time Armed Forces Chess Champion and earned the title of International Master in 1988. His games were characterized by creativity and a willingness to take risks, which set him apart from other players.
One of Emory’s most famous victories was against Grandmaster Viswanathan Anand in 1988. This win solidified his reputation as a formidable opponent and showcased his ability to compete with the best in the world.
Notable Tournaments and Wins
- Armed Forces Chess Championship (1983, 1986, 1988, 1991, 1997)
- International Master title (1988)
- Victory against Viswanathan Anand (1988)
Personality and Playing Style
Emory Tate’s personality was as dynamic as his playing style. He was known for his flair, humor, and ability to captivate audiences with his storytelling. His height and charismatic demeanor made him a natural entertainer, both on and off the chessboard.
In terms of playing style, Emory was a tactical genius. He often employed unconventional strategies that caught his opponents off guard. His willingness to take risks and think outside the box earned him a reputation as one of the most creative players of his time.
